@interactify-live/player-react-native

React Native library for Interactify player with media display, interactive widgets, and real-time MQTT integration.

Installation

This library requires react-native-video as a peer dependency. Install it first:

npm install react-native-video
# or
yarn add react-native-video

Then install this library:

npm install @interactify-live/player-react-native
# or
yarn add @interactify-live/player-react-native

Peer Dependencies

  • react: >=16.8.0
  • react-native: >=0.60.0
  • react-native-video: >=5.0.0

Quick Start

import React from "react";
import { InteractifyPlayer } from "@interactify-live/player-react-native";

const App = () => {
  const media = {
    id: "test-stream",
    type: "video",
    url: "https://example.com/video.mp4",
  };

  const interactions = [
    {
      interaction: "text",
      geometric: {
        x: 20,
        y: 20,
        width: 200,
        height: 50,
      },
      payload: {
        text: "Amazing Video!",
        size: 18,
        color: "#ffffff",
        background: "rgba(0,0,0,0.8)",
        borderRadius: 8,
      },
    },
  ];

  const options = {
    user_id: "USER_ID",
    token: "TOKEN",
    scope: "short",
    space_slug: "SPACE_SLUG",
    slug: "SLUG",
    session: "SESSION",
  };

  return (
    <InteractifyPlayer
      media={media}
      interactions={interactions}
      autoPlay={true}
      muted={true}
      loop={true}
      isDraggable={true}
      options={options}
      onPlay={() => console.log("Started playing")}
      onPause={() => console.log("Paused")}
      onError={(error) => console.error("Error:", error)}
      onStatusChange={(status) => console.log("Connection:", status)}
      onNewMessageReceived={(message) => console.log("Message:", message)}
    />
  );
};

API Reference

InteractifyPlayer Props

interface InteractifyPlayerProps {
  // Media configuration
  media: {
    id: string;
    type: "video" | "image";
    url: string;
    thumbnail?: string;
    alt?: string;
  };

  // Interactive widgets configuration
  interactions: any[];

  // Media playback options
  autoPlay?: boolean;
  muted?: boolean;
  loop?: boolean;
  isDraggable?: boolean;

  // Event handlers
  onPlay?: () => void;
  onPause?: () => void;
  onEnded?: () => void;
  onTimeUpdate?: (time: number) => void;
  onError?: (error: Error) => void;
  onInteractionClick?: (interaction: any) => void;
  onInteractionDragEnd?: (
    index: number,
    geometric: { x: number; y: number; width: number; height: number }
  ) => void;
  onVideoReady?: (videoRef: any) => void;

  // UI customization
  loadingIndicator?: ReactNode;
  errorIndicator?: ReactNode;
  className?: string;
  style?: any;

  // MQTT connection options
  options?: {
    user_id: string;
    token: string;
    scope: "short" | "live";
    space_slug: string;
    slug: string;
    session: string;
    brokerUrl?: string;
  };

  // MQTT event handlers
  onStatusChange?: (status: string) => void;
  onNewMessageReceived?: (message: any) => void;
}

InteractifyPlayerHandle Methods

interface InteractifyPlayerHandle {
  // Media control
  play: () => void;
  pause: () => void;
  mute: () => void;
  unmute: () => void;
  getCurrentTime: () => number;
  setCurrentTime: (time: number) => void;
  isMuted: () => boolean;
  isPlaying: () => boolean;

  // Widget management
  setInteractions: (interactions: any[]) => void;

  // Video element access
  getVideoElement: () => any;
  loadStream: (stream: any) => void;

  // MQTT actions
  publishEvent: (type: string) => void;
  sendMessage: (message: {
    text: string;
    avatar?: string;
    displayName?: string;
    visible?: boolean;
    replyTo?: {
      text: string;
      userID: string;
      displayName: string;
    };
  }) => void;
  subscribeToNewMessages: (callback: (message: any) => void) => () => void;
}

Using with Ref

import React, { useRef } from "react";
import {
  InteractifyPlayer,
  InteractifyPlayerHandle,
} from "@interactify-live/player-react-native";

const App = () => {
  const playerRef = useRef<InteractifyPlayerHandle>(null);

  const handleLike = () => {
    playerRef.current?.publishEvent("like");
  };

  const handleSendMessage = () => {
    playerRef.current?.sendMessage({
      text: "Hello from React Native!",
      displayName: "User",
      avatar: "https://example.com/avatar.jpg",
    });
  };

  return (
    <InteractifyPlayer
      ref={playerRef}
      media={media}
      interactions={interactions}
      options={options}
      // ... other props
    />
  );
};

Features

  • 🎥 Media Display: Video and image playback with HLS support
  • 🎨 Interactive Widgets: Text overlays and interactive elements with drag, resize, and rotation
  • 🔌 MQTT Integration: Real-time messaging and analytics
  • 📱 React Native Optimized: Built specifically for mobile apps
  • 🎮 Event Handling: Comprehensive event system for media and interactions
  • 🎯 TypeScript Support: Full type safety and IntelliSense
